Jeff Penza Declared On Two Runners At Kembla Grange (Saturday)

Please be advised that Racing NSW Stewards have permitted Jeff Penza to be declared as the rider of both No.9 Rogue Missile (trainer Ron Leemon) and No.14 (2nd Emergency) All Things in Time (Glen Thompson) which have accepted for Race 6 at Saturday’s Kembla Grange race meeting.

Should All Things in Time gain a start, Ron Leemon will be required to find a suitable rider for Rogue Missile.
